Just thirty-four years old, clever and ambitious, a dedicated Party man, Brukhanov had come to western Ukraine with orders to begin building what—if the Soviet central planners had their way—would become the greatest nuclear power station on earth.
Midnight in Chernobyl: The Untold Story of the World's Greatest Nuclear Disaster
